Epoxy Easy to Clean Grout

General Information
Definition
Three-component, solvent-free, epoxy-resin-based, chemical resistant, easy-cleanable grout.
Usage Areas
Grouting applications of surface coating materials such as Antiasit porcelain tiles, granite, natural stone, marble etc, for 2-10 mm joints, In industries like food, textile, pharmaceutical and hospitals, thermal swimming pools where hygiene is required, In industrial places where high chemical and mechanical strength required, Laboratory benches and commercial kitchen working areas, Provides excellent results for joints in saline or thermal swimming pools, wastewater treatment plants.
Package
  • In 5 kg units and plastic pails (3 component) Component A: 3.85 kg Component B: 0.31 kg Component C: 0.84 kg
Features
Easily apply and clean. Excellent chemical and mechanical resistance. Suitable for joints between 2-10 mm widths. Stain resistant. Hygienic thanks to its low water absorption. Easy to clean thanks to its smooth surface. Crack, abrasion resistant and durable. Easy to apply with 60 minutes pot life at 23°C.
Professional Knowledge

Technical Properties (at 23°C and 50% RH)
General Data
 Appearance: Component A: White, Grey, Beige viscose liquid

Component B: Yellow-green transparent liquid

Component C: Off-white powder

 Shelf Life: 12 months when stored in the original sealed packing in a cool, dry place.
 Components (A/B/C): Epoxy resin / Hardener / Filler
Application Data
 Application Temperature Range: (+10°C) – (+27°C)
 Pot Life: 60 minutes at 25°C
 Ready for Use (Max. Chemical Resistance): 7 hours Set to Foot Traffic 24 hours
 Consumption: As a grout see epoxy grout consumption table
Performance Data
Flexural Strength (EN 12808-3): ≥ 30 N/mm²
 Compressive Strength (EN 12808-3): ≥ 45 N/mm²
 Abrasion Resistance (EN 12808-2): ≤ 250 mm³
 Shrinkage (EN 12808-4): ≤ 1.5 mm/m
  Water Absorption (after 240 min) (EN 12808-5): ≤ 0.1 gr
 Service Temperature Range (after final cure): (-20°C) – (+80°C)
